ALEXANDRIA, Va., April 21 -- United States Patent no. 12,608,982, issued on April 21, was assigned to IntegenX Inc. (Pleasanton, Calif.).
"Systems and methods for biometric data collections" was invented by Robert A. Schueren (Los Altos Hills, Calif.), David King (Menlo Park, Calif.), Chungsoo Charles Park (Redwood City, Calif.) and Stevan B. Jovanovich (Livermore, Calif.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A system comprises an authentication sub-system configured to authenticate a user and a biochemical analysis sub-system configured to perform a biochemical analysis on a biological sample provided to the biochemical analysis sub-system.
